2 Timothy 2:11-13

SCRIPTURE 2 Timothy 2:11–13 “It is a faithful saying: For if we be dead with him, we shall also live with him:  If we suffer, we shall also reign with him: if we deny him, he also will deny us: If we believe not, yet he abideth faithful: he cannot deny himself.”  

COMMENTARY This is also reflected in Matthew 10:32-33 as well. If we deny Jesus, our Lord will deny us.  Again, this passage is written to believers, not unbelievers.  It should be noted that the idea that “he abideth faithful” does not mean that if we lose faith (shown in other Scripture), we will remain saved because He is faithful.  God has shown that He is utterly faithful to His promises but that those to whom the promises did not always receive them; that is God found others which received the promises.  I wonder what proponents of guaranteed, unconditional eternal security would say the result of Jesus denying us before the Father actually is.
